Since this spectroscopy strategy counts on the use of light, allow's very first take into consideration the buildings of light. Light has a certain quantity of energy which is vice versa symmetrical to its wavelength. Thus, much shorter wavelengths of light bring even more energy and longer wavelengths lug less power. A particular amount of energy is needed to promote electrons in a substance to a greater energy state which we can discover as absorption.


This is why the absorption of light takes place for various wavelengths in different compounds. Humans are able to see a spectrum of noticeable light, from roughly 380 nm, which we see as violet, to 780 nm, which we see as red. 1 UV light has wavelengths shorter than that of noticeable light to around 100 nm.
